Colorimeter

A colorimeter is an essential analytical instrument designed to measure the absorbance of particular wavelengths of light by a specific solution. Its core utility revolves around quantifying the concentration of substances in various samples by assessing their color intensity. Widely used across medical laboratories and veterinary clinics, colorimeters help ensure precision in diagnostics, quality control, and research applications.

The application of colorimeters extends to multiple scientific fields for analyzing solution compositions with speed and accuracy. This versatile equipment often complements broader spectrophotometric techniques, providing quicker results in clinical environments where dependable color measurement translates into better patient outcomes. Spectrocolorimeter: Advanced Color Measurement Technology


A spectrocolorimeter enhances traditional colorimetry by measuring light intensity across the visible spectrum, providing detailed spectral data beyond simple color intensity. This advanced instrument allows for precise color characterization, useful in more sophisticated clinical, veterinary, and research laboratories where color differentiation impacts diagnostic insights.

Spectrocolorimeters can analyze samples with high accuracy by capturing spectral profiles, enabling comparisons against standards or detecting subtle changes in biological fluids or solutions. This technology supports a broad range of applications such as tissue analysis, pathology, and veterinary diagnostics, delivering comprehensive colorimetric data that help improve interpretation reliability.

Key Factors to Consider

When choosing a colorimeter, important factors include spectral range, accuracy, and ease of calibration. These characteristics determine how precisely the device can measure absorbance and distinguish subtle color differences in biological samples. Also consider sample handling features and compatibility with diagnostic protocols to maximize clinical utility.

Another key consideration is the instrument’s user interface and software capabilities. Intuitive operation and data management improve workflow efficiency, which is critical in busy clinical and veterinary environments. The robustness of the device against routine lab conditions and ease of maintenance also impact long-term performance.
